We’ll take a look at the most commonly effective ones here as there are many options when seeking hemroid treatment.
Adding extra fiber to your diet, as well as drinking a lot of water prevents constipation. Constipation causes strain on your bowel muscles, which will make hemroids worse.
* Hemroid symptoms are common to most nuts, coffee, alcohol, food tends to get worse all the hot dishes. Try to avoid eating another type of food if you observe that it is making your hemroids worse and check if there is an improvement.
* Use ice on the area for 10 minutes, then follow with a warm, moist towel for 20 minutes to provide relief.
Using unscented baby wipes is a better way then wiping or rubbing after bowel movement.
Just sit or stand in one place without moving much.
In bad flared up piles, bed rest helps by taking away the pressure from the sphincter muscle and allowing the hemroids to subdue.
Some get relief by taking sitz bath several times a day ,for that soak the affected area in warm water for about 15 minutes..
* Stop using any soaps or other products with dyes or perfumes; switch to products that don’t have as many chemicals.
* Cotton undergarments will help absorb any moisture, perhaps from sweating, that can make hemroids worse.
Baby diaper rash cream contains Zinc which is a skin protectant and can be applied to protect and Prevent the delicate skin from itching.
Suppositories, for example Tucks and Preparation H, are a hemroid treatment that must be used with care, if they are used longer than the recommended 7-10 days, damage to the anal tissue can be the unfortunate result.
Anti-inflamitories such as hydrocortisone creams that can help inflammation as well as itching are available at your drugstore. If an over the counter treatment does not give you relief, you doctor can give you a stronger prescription.
You don’t have to suffer unnecessary pain as there is a wide variety of numbing sprays at your local drugstore.
